I'd like to add a package for spin to the tree (it's used at several |
2 |
universities, including mine and Caltech). |
3 |
|
4 |
However, it's not straightforward. The basic license is for educational |
5 |
purposes only. |
6 |
|
7 |
Here are my suggestions how to implement that. |
8 |
|
9 |
/usr/portage/licenses/spin-educational with the following content: |
10 |
|
11 |
Copyright (c) 1989-2006 Lucent Technologies, Bell Labs |
12 |
Extensions (c) 2006-2009 NASA/JPL California Institute of Technology |
13 |
All Rights Reserved. For educational purposes only. |
14 |
No guarantee whatsoever is expressed or implied by |
15 |
the distribution of this code. |
16 |
|
17 |
/usr/portage/licenses/spin-commercial with the content pasted from |
18 |
http://www.spinroot.com/spin/spin_license.html |
19 |
|
20 |
And then in the ebuild: |
21 |
|
22 |
LICENSE="|| ( spin-educational spin-commercial )" |
23 |
|
24 |
Are there any license groups these should be added to? |
